Mountain States Plants Salary

As of August 2026, the average hourly salary for employees at Mountain States Plants in the United States is $43. This translates to an approximate annual wage of $90,259. Salaries at Mountain States Plants typically range from $38 to $49 hourly,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

About Mountain States Plants
We specialize in quality products at a fair price with excellent service. As growers and marketers of fresh, quality potted blooming plants in the western United States, we distribute through mass marketers, wholesalers, interior landscapers, and florists. Mountain States Plants is a wholesale plant and flower distributor. We have been in business for over 50 years. We raise our own plants and flo

What Is the Cost of Living Near Layton?

Understanding the cost of living near Layton is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Mountain States Plants.
Layton's Cost of Living Index is approximately 99.8 (0.2% less expensive than US average; 1.7% less than UT average). Northern UT city (Hill AFB), housing near US avg. UTA. When planning your budget based on a salary from Mountain States Plants,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,100 - $1,600+ A significant portion of Mountain States Plants sal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$100 - $190 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$85 (UTA mon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$400 - $580 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$350 - $650+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$370 - $680+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,405 - $3,705+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
